Warren Buffett has said he doesn't do due diligence. This was a statement about Precision Castparts which is one of his largest acquisitions ever. And everybody just ignored that comment, but it was a profound comment. And what he meant by it was that he didn't need to do due diligence. He had been reading every 10-K published by Precision... Due diligence in early-stage investing is the voluntary act of looking into a business or individual before giving them your money. Due to the small amounts of money at stake, say $25,000 from a typical individual angel, many folks skip this step.
